PGA suspends Daly six months
Jan 1, 2009 - 12:52 AM BRISTOL, Connecticut (Ticker) -- John Daly has been suspended from the PGA tour for six months, according to multiple reports.The ban is reportedly for conduct that has brought unwelcome publicity to the tour, including an incident in October when he spent a night in jail in North Carolina sobering up after being taken into custody at a local Hooters restaurant.
Daly, who is a two-time major championship winner, was previously suspended from the tour in 1992-93. He has battled alcohol and weight problems throughout his career.
The 42-year-old will continue to play on the European tour.
